Complete set · 17capabilities

The complete Plone capability set.

These are the exact actions your AI can choose when you ask it to work with Plone.

Capability set01 / 05

01—04

4 capabilities in this set.

Part of 17 available through Plone.

  1. 01 Capability

    Update content

    Perform partial updates on existing content objects. This lets you change a few fields without re-saving the whole page.

  2. 02 Capability

    Create group

    Create a new group to organize your users and permissions. It helps manage access across different sections.

  3. 03 Capability

    Create user

    Create a new user account within the CMS. Use this to onboard new team members to your platform.

  4. 04 Capability

    Delete content

    Remove a content object from your site structure. This is useful for cleaning up old pages or folders.

Can I use Plone MCP to update my website content?

Yes. You can ask your AI client to find specific pages and update their content, titles, or metadata using natural language commands.

How does Plone MCP help with user management?

It allows you to create new users, manage group memberships, and update user profiles without having to navigate the CMS admin dashboard.

Can I move content through its lifecycle with Plone MCP?

Yes. Your agent can trigger workflow transitions to move content from draft to review or from review to published status automatically.

Does Plone MCP work with Cursor or Claude?

It works with any MCP-compatible client, including Claude, Cursor, and Windsurf, allowing you to manage your CMS from your favorite capabilities.

Can I search for content in Plone using natural language?

Yes. You can use full-text search to find any content object by its name or keywords, rather than needing to know the exact folder path.

Can I search for specific content types like Folders or Documents?

Yes! Use the search_content capability and provide the portal_type parameter (e.g., 'Folder' or 'Document') to filter your results.

How do I update the title or description of an existing page?

Use the update_content capability. Provide the path to the content and a json_body containing the fields you want to change, such as {"title": "New Title"}.

Is it possible to manage user accounts through this server?

Yes, if your credentials have sufficient permissions, you can use list_users, get_user, and create_user to manage the site's membership.
